Output abcb99e77f11dbb7528638c458694df5a9170c234f33675b807b92e2e0a3321d:0

value
21802514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06911693a736901e1d369277aba07fdfcac055a3 OP_EQUAL
address
32Hjnbh6d4uvjWjm34mdbW7mnmTymTz7WA
transaction
abcb99e77f11dbb7528638c458694df5a9170c234f33675b807b92e2e0a3321d
confirmations
351060
spent
true